KUALA LUMPUR, 18 September 2025 – Kao Malaysia today announced its first-ever academic partnership in Malaysia with Universiti Malaya (UM), marking a new milestone in advancing science-backed skincare and community wellbeing. The collaboration was formalised through the signing of a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U), following the successful completion of Bioré's "Skin Protection, Life Perfection" campaign.

This partnership is also part of Kao Malaysia's 1% pledge from Bioré product sales to fund local skin health research and education initiatives. "This partnership reflects Kao's commitment to going beyond product innovation to create meaningful, science-driven impact in the communities we serve," said Mr. Yamazaki Hirobumi, President of Kao Malaysia. "We believe that skin protection is not just a personal care choice, but a public health responsibility. Together with Universiti Malaya, we are proud to advance this vision for the benefit of all Malaysians."

The "Skin Protection, Life Perfection" campaign, launched in May 2025 with Watsons, championed skin protection as the key to confidence and wellbeing. Powered by Bioré's "Cleanse. Protect." philosophy, the initiative combined expert-led education, interactive consumer engagement, and exclusive Watsons member rewards.
With the MoU, Kao Malaysia and Universiti Malaya are extending this effort beyond the campaign, laying the foundation for long-term research, sustainable skincare education, and meaningful community transformation.
